Agriculture: Pioneering Sustainable Innovation

Agriculture is at the forefront of innovation, leveraging cutting-edge technologies to enhance productivity and sustainability. Farmers are adopting tools like drones, IoT sensors, and data analytics to optimize crop yields while reducing environmental impact. Urban farming techniques, such as vertical farming and hydroponics, are bringing fresh produce to city dwellers, strengthening local food systems. These advancements ensure agriculture remains a vital pillar of global food security, supporting communities with eco-conscious practices.
